From b4365423bb7adf9feb4659126eaec374dfbde806 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Chanwoo Choi Date: Wed, 7 Oct 2020 22:02:39 +0900 Subject: PM / devfreq: Unify frequency change to devfreq_update_target func The update_devfreq() and update_passive_devfreq() have the duplicate code when changing the target frequency on final stage. So, unify frequency change code to devfreq_update_target() to remove the duplicate code and to centralize the frequency change code.
